LAND BOARD.
MONTHLY MEETING. The Canterbury Land Board met yesterday. Present —Messrs C. It. Pollen (chairman}, J. Stevenson, R. Macaulay, ail/] .J. Scaly, An application for thf> transfer of Section Block XII., Cheviot, 02 aert's 1 rood, W. T. Pain to Cheviot Hacing Chili, postponed from the last meeting, was refused.
